Patents by Inventor Govinda Raj Sambamurthy

Govinda Raj Sambamurthy has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20120185732
    Abstract: Systems and methods are described for diagnosing behavior of software components in an application server. The application server can comprise a plurality of components that process incoming requests. A diagnostics advisor can be deployed with the application server and can determine an efficiency and/or inefficiency of each of the components of the application server or other middleware system. The efficiency determined by computing a ratio of a number of requests that completed execution in the component during a particular sampling time period to the number of requests that were received by the component during the sampling time period. The inefficiency is the inverse of efficiency, i.e. it is a ratio of the number of requests that are still being executed by the one or more components at the end of the sampling time period to the number of requests that were received by the one or more components during the sampling time period.
    Type: Application
    Filed: January 19, 2011
    Publication date: July 19, 2012
    Applicant: ORACLE INTERNATIONAL CORPORATION
    Inventors: Raji Sankar, Govinda Raj Sambamurthy, Rahul Goyal, Ashwin Kumar Karkala, Sandeep Pandita
  • Publication number: 20120185441
    Abstract: A mechanism for efficient collection of data is described for runtime middleware environments. Two frequencies are used, a collection frequency (CF) to collect the data and an aggregation frequency (AF) to aggregate and persist the data in a repository. The collection cycle is a shorter time interval than the aggregation cycle. An agent residing in the container periodically collects a set of data upon every collection cycle from the components of the middleware system and caches the set of data locally. Upon every aggregation cycle, the agent applies an aggregation function to the collected set of data and persists the set of data into a repository after the aggregation function has been applied. The aggregation function is such that it resulting data represents the behavior of the runtime environment in the total duration of the aggregation cycle.
    Type: Application
    Filed: January 19, 2011
    Publication date: July 19, 2012
    Applicant: ORACLE INTERNATIONAL CORPORATION
    Inventors: Raji Sankar, Govinda Raj Sambamurthy, Rahul Goyal, Vinay Kumar Jaasti
  • Publication number: 20120185735
    Abstract: A method of determining a root cause of a performance problem is provided. The method comprises analyzing a plurality of performance indicators/metrics in a first time period and determining that at least one performance indicators/metric is exhibiting abnormal behavior. The method further comprises analyzing the plurality of performance indicators/metrics over a second time period, the second time period is longer than the first time period, and determining trend information for each performance indicators/metric over the second time period. The method further comprises correlating the trend information for each performance indicators/metric with performance problem information stored in a knowledge base, identifying a potential cause of the abnormal behavior based on the correlation, and alerting a user of the potential cause.
    Type: Application
    Filed: January 19, 2011
    Publication date: July 19, 2012
    Applicant: ORACLE INTERNATIONAL CORPORATION
    Inventors: Govinda Raj Sambamurthy, Raji Sankar, Rahul Goyal, Ashwin Kumar Karkala